Step-by-Step: How to List the Multiples of 9700

A multiple of n is the result of multiplying n by any natural number (1, 2, 3, ...). To list the first k multiples, just multiply 9700 by each integer from 1 to k:

  1. 9700 × 1 = 9700
  2. 9700 × 2 = 19400
  3. 9700 × 3 = 29100
  4. …continue up to 9700 × 20 = 194000.
  5. Sum of these 20 multiples: 9700 × (1+2+…+20) = 9700 × 210 = 2037000.

Shortcut: the sum of the first 20 multiples of 9700 always equals 210n, since 1+2+…+20 = 210.

Facts About Multiples

  • Any number is a multiple of itself (n × 1 = n).
  • Any number is a multiple of 1 (1 × n = n).
  • Zero is a multiple of any number (0 × n = 0).
  • The set of multiples of a number is infinite — every natural-number multiplier produces another multiple.
  • If two numbers a and b are multiplied, the product a × b is a common multiple of both (but not necessarily the least common multiple — LCM).

The set of multiples of n can be represented as Mn = {0, 1·n, 2·n, 3·n, …}. For example: M9700 = {0, 9700, 19400, 29100, 38800, …}.
